Review 5 of 5 Strengths: easy installation. Weaknesses: Tiny buttons; website advertised unit as having 4V pre-out output, but actual has 1.8V (which was important in the way I was attempting to install it); the lack of customer service; display is just too bright at night; the silver tone receiver color is ugly; have to go though the adjustment of bal, treble, bass, etc. to get back to volume and other controls. Sloppy layout, confusing controls, and hard to read buttons make this unit a accident waiting to happen. Summary: I paid $349 for this unit though a online dealer and would not recommend this unit to anyone. I attempted to return it to the place where purchased, however, they wanted a 15% restocking fee plus shipping. I sold it, and lost $50 dollars. Similar Products Used: JVC unit cassette/ CD bought in 1990; easy controls; great design; a little confusing, but not on the controls that mattered.
